btrfs: setting a label is only supported on a mount point #966

I noticed that setting a label is only supported via a mountpoint for btrfs, while in theory a label can be set on a device.

btrfs filesystem label [<device>|<mountpoint>] [<newlabel>]

Most other set_label functions seem to use the device. Which in Cockpit leads a somewhat inconsistent experience when the filesystem is not mounted. (In theory we can work around it by first mounting it temporary, set label and umount).

Changing the API over to a mountpoint would break libblockdev's API so I guess that is a not an option and this isn't a real "breaking" or high priority issue for us. (Read: no issue at all)
